DISTINGUISHING FEATURES OF THE CLASS : An employee in this class operates a crane for bridge and highway repair, construction and maintenance projects and other public works activities. This class differs from that of a Heavy Motor Equipment Operator II due to the more complex nature of equipment operated requiring greater skill and knowledge along with increased responsibility to others. Additionally, incumbents are required to be eligible for a special license to operate and service equipment operated. The work is performed under direct supervision with leeway allowed for exercise of independent judgment in carrying out the details of the work. Does related work as required.

TYPICAL WORK ACTIVITIES

  • Operates crane to unload and load materials;
  • Performs regular inspections of crane;
  • Maintains daily log for crane;
  • Responsible for understanding the bearing capacity of soils to ensure safe support for the crane and loads to be lifted;
  • Reads load charts and determines safe loads and reach;
  • Responsible for ensuring loads lifted meet rigging procedures;
  • Responsible for accurately estimating and/or determining weights of picks;
  • Communicates with supervisors, engineering, operators, and others about crane operations and requirements;
  • Performs routine cleaning and maintenance on crane and other equipment, such as changing oil, greasing, minor mechanical repairs, etc.;
  • Operates other specialized heavy equipment;
  • May transport equipment from one site to another;
  • Does related tasks in the building and maintenance of roadways, flood control dams, drainage ditches, and other construction projects;
  • May assist in training;
  • Does other related tasks as required.

FULL PERFORMANCES, KNOWLEDGES, SKILLS ABILITIES AND PERSONAL CHARACTERISTICS

Thorough knowledge of crane operation; through knowledge of crane maintenance; thorough knowledge of safe crane operation and load rigging; thorough knowledge of rules and regulations regarding crane operation such as OSHA 1926, and ANSI Code 30.5; good knowledge of the operation and maintenance of other specialized heavy equipment; ability to make minor repairs, good manual dexterity; good mechanical ability; good visual acuity; ability to follow oral and written instructions.

MINIMUM QUALIFICATIONS
Three (3) years of satisfactory experience in the operation of specialized heavy motor equipment such as Crane, Backhoe, Excavator, Loader, etc.

PREFERRED QUALIFICATIONS:

Crane Operator Certification

  • New York State: NCCCO Certification
  • Outside of New York State and New York City: Certificate of Competence from DOL

SPECIAL REQUIREMENT:

  1. Possession of a valid Commercial Driver's License appropriate for class.
  2. Must pass drug screening prior to employment.
